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Cebu Boobook | Crescent Nail-tail Wallaby |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Aves (Birds)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Strigiformes (Owls) | Diprotodontia (Marsupials) |
| Family | Strigidae (True Owls) | Macropodidae (Kangaroos) |
| Genus | Ninox | Onychogalea |
| Species | Ninox rumseyi | Onychogalea lunata |
Evolutionary Relationship
Cebu Boobook and Crescent Nail-tail Wallaby share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
